
Habitat: Dry woodlands, dunes, old fields, clearings, and roadsides. Common in the coastal Plain and piedmont; infrequent at low elevations in the mountains.
Wildlife Value: Flowers are a nectar source for bees and butterflies and seeds are consumed by songbirds, quail and wild turkeys. It is a host plant for the Cloudless Sulphur (Phoebis sennae), Little Yellow (Pyrisitia lisa), and Sleepy Orange (Eurema nicippe) larvae. Partridge pea often grows in dense stands, producing litter and plant stalks that furnish cover for upland game birds, small mammals, small non-game birds, and waterfowl.
